The popular e-commerce website StorEnvy known for its online store building and social marketplace has been hacked. As a result, personal details of over 1.5 million customers and merchants have been leaked online on a hacker forum for free download, Hackread.com has learned. Launched in 2012; the St., Chico, CA-based company is home to millions of customers who are now at risk. According to the database seen by Hackread.com, the data contains emails, passwords, full names, usernames, IP addresses, city, gender, and links to social media profiles.
